Output ed52badc368acdcd8318e8f70edb8993177dff7fe998e49af98e3114d484462e:12

value
893740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f0c1d8353cda5b555f9ac396dc12380206f457 OP_EQUAL
address
3PHqovHrwEzngg4zcRhzUcerotPMC6uvHR
transaction
ed52badc368acdcd8318e8f70edb8993177dff7fe998e49af98e3114d484462e
confirmations
209245
spent
true